Wall-Mounted Garage Shelving vs. Freestanding Shelving Solutions: Which One Works Best for You?

One of the very first decisions you’ll have to make when choosing a storage solution is whether you should buy a wall-mounted or freestanding garage shelving system. Understanding which one works better for you will optimise your space and create a more seamless experience.

Freestanding Shelving

Freestanding garage shelving units are one of the most popular options across Australia because of their versatility and easy instalment. There is no drilling required, and you can reposition the fixture whenever your layout changes – it is not a permanent fixture and does not require a full remodel.

Freestanding shelving works best if you:

  • Are renting your home and cannot make permanent changes to your space
  • Want quick installation without making permanent changes to your space
  • Like flexibility and versatility – change the position whenever you want
  • Need efficient storage for medium to heavy items

Wall-Mounted Shelving

Wall-mounted shelving systems offer a permanent storage solution for your garage space. It is all about maximising space and optimising storage. By lifting items off the floor, you can free up room for workbenches, vehicles, and larger gear, increasing valuable floorspace.

This is often the garage shelving Australia homeowners choose when:

  • Floor space is limited
  • You want a cleaner, more organised garage with more open space
  • You store lighter or more frequently used items and want easier access

Proper installation is vital here – because the fixture is permanent and requires anchoring into wall studs, safety and making sure it is secure is the number one priority.

Understanding the Importance of Weight Capacity (And Why It Matters)

One of the most overlooked factors when researching garage shelving solutions is weight capacity.

Every shelf has a weight threshold, and surpassing this can become a safety concern. Exceeding the recommended limit can lead to instability, bending of materials, and even collapse. Collapsed shelving can result in injury if you are in the space at the time.

As a general guide, follow the table below:

Shelving Type Weight Capacity (Per Shelf) Best For Recommended Use
Light-Duty Shelving Up to 50kg Small tools, cleaning products, paint tins, everyday items Optimal for lighter garage shelving solutions, storage cupboards, utility areas
Medium-Duty Shelving 50kg – 100kg Camping gear, storage tubs, archive boxes, power tools General-purpose garage shelving units for most households (most common choice)
Heavy-Duty Shelving 150kg+ Bulk materials, engine parts, heavy equipment, larger tools, toolboxes Serious storage for workshop environments where the best garaging shelving strength is required
Extra Heavy-Duty Shelving 250kg+ (varies by model and make) Machinery components, commercial tools, large inventory Large garages and trade workshops that require durable and strong shelving systems for larger items.

 

If you are unsure on which shelving capacity you require, it is always best to opt for systems rated higher than you think you need. It improves overall stability, durability, and longevity.

What Material Works Best in Australian Garages?

Australia’s unpredictable and sometimes unrelenting climate can put immense amount of pressure on storage systems. Heat, humidity, and even dust all plays key roles in how well shelving holds up over time. That is why there are three commonly used materials that work best in Australian garages, and these are, plastic, steel, and timber shelving.

Steel Shelving

Steel shelving is widely considered as the best garage shelving in Australia, as it is renowned for its ability to withstand harsh weather, making it a durable and strong option for homeowners. Powder-coated steel frames also actively resist rust and handle heavy loads with ease.

This makes steel shelving systems reliable long-term solutions for most garages, making it the most popular option.

Timber Shelving

Timber shelving systems also offer a reliable shelving solution, as they provide a flat, solid surface that works better for smaller tools and loose items.

Timber shelving often has lower weight capacities, making them more ideal for lighter storage items. Also, because of their flat surface, they can prevent items from falling through the gaps.

Plastic Shelving

Plastic shelving solutions are ideal for garages that are in damp or humid environments because of their rustproof, moisture-resistant surface. These systems are also lightweight and more affordable than other metal options and require little to no maintenance.
